Aus-founded InteractSport acquired by international giant Sportradar

Global sports data intelligence and entertainment solutions provider Sportradar, has reached an agreement to acquire Melbourne-founded InteractSport.

The acquisition for the sports data and technology company is expected to be completed in the second half of 2021, subject to regulatory approvals.

Founded in Melbourne in 2002 by Andrew Walton, with a particular focus on cricket, InteractSport has partnerships with international organisations such as Football Australia, Cricket Australia and the England & Wales Cricket Board.

CEO of Interact Sport, Sam Taylor said: “InteractSport has always been driven by innovation and
delivering cutting edge solutions that benefit sports organisations and their fans. Aligning with
Sportradar is a natural step in achieving our company vision – it enables us to scale our operation to develop exciting new products, reach new markets and deliver even greater benefit to our current and future customers.

A statement from Sportradar said: “By combining Sportradar’s leading commercialisation and distribution framework with InteractSport’s products, content creation capabilities and subject matter expertise, Sportradar is creating the opportunity to unlock significant growth within regional and global markets for its customers.”

Carsten Koerl, CEO of Sportradar Group stated: “This acquisition provides Sportradar with the opportunity to widen its data and content offering. With cricket being one of the most popular sports in the world, we see this as a growth opportunity for the company, especially given the significance of the sport in the Asian region.”

InteractSports has offices in Melbourne and London, UK.
